我正在尝试让我的设备调试我的软件,但它不会显示在AVD列表中。 ADB可以看到它,Eclipse设备管理器也可以看到它。我可以使用adb等获得交互式shell。
C:\Program Files (x86)\Android\android-sdk\platform-tools>adb devices
List of devices attached
BX9038ZRUV device
有谁知道发生了什么以及我该如何解决? 我正在运行Windows 7,而我的手机是运行Android 4.0.4的Sony Ericson Xperia S.
答案 0 :(得分:3)
avd仅适用于虚拟设备。你要做的是:
运行配置>更改为“每次运行应用时询问”或您的真实设备。
答案 1 :(得分:0)
AVD代表Android虚拟设备,您的手机是真实的。运行或调试应用程序时,它应显示在“选择目标”列表中。
答案 2 :(得分:0)
AVD仅列出虚拟设备(模拟器)。在run config!
中选择“始终提示选择设备”